General Contractor Services involve overseeing and managing construction or renovation projects from start to finish. These services typically include coordinating various trades, managing schedules, sourcing materials, and ensuring that the project adheres to specified plans and standards. By handling the logistics and administrative aspects, general contractors help streamline the construction process, reducing the complexity for property owners and ensuring that each phase of the project progresses smoothly.
One of the primary problems General Contractor Services address is the challenge of managing multiple subcontractors and vendors. Without professional oversight, projects can face delays, miscommunications, or budget overruns. General contractors serve as a central point of contact, resolving issues as they arise and maintaining consistent communication among all parties involved. This helps mitigate common construction problems such as scheduling conflicts, quality inconsistencies, or unforeseen site issues, ultimately leading to a more organized and efficient project execution.

Project Management Costs - Typically, project management fees for general contractor services range from 8% to 15% of the total construction budget. For a project costing $50,000, this could amount to $4,000 to $7,500. These costs cover coordination, scheduling, and oversight of the construction process.
Labor and Materials - Labor costs for general contractor services usually account for 30% to 50% of the total project expenses, depending on scope and complexity. For example, a $100,000 project might have labor and materials costs between $30,000 and $50,000. This includes subcontractor fees, materials, and equipment usage.
Permitting and Inspection Fees - Permitting and inspection costs vary by location but often range from $1,000 to $5,000 for typical residential projects. In Burbank, CA, these fees are included in the overall project budget and depend on the scope of work and local regulations.
Contingency and Miscellaneous Expenses - Contingency funds generally account for 5% to 10% of the total project cost to cover unforeseen expenses. For a $75,000 project, this might be $3,750 to $7,500, ensuring budget flexibility for unexpected issues during construction.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a general contractor, it's essential to evaluate their experience in handling projects similar to yours. Homeowners should look for professionals with a proven track record in residential or commercial projects within their local area, such as Burbank, CA. Clear, written expectations regarding project scope, timelines, and deliverables help ensure that both parties are aligned and can prevent misunderstandings during the construction process.
Reputable references are a valuable resource when comparing local general contractors. Homeowners are encouraged to seek out testimonials or reviews from previous clients to gauge a contractor’s reliability and quality of work. Verifying references can provide insights into their work ethic, professionalism, and ability to complete projects on schedule, helping to build confidence in their capabilities.
Effective communication is a key factor in the success of any construction project. Homeowners should prioritize contractors who demonstrate transparency and responsiveness in their interactions. Establishing clear channels of communication from the outset, including how updates are provided and how questions are addressed, can facilitate a smoother project experience.
